Output 33fb572598f65150570baaebd59a058c96c077aa2e984d2197dfccccdb7179e9:8

value
24996
script pubkey
OP_0 OP_PUSHBYTES_20 7596bbe1afdc346157cc21a69cc9a5b95bdc1ccb
address
bc1qwktthcd0ms6xz47vyxnfejd9h9dac8xth7a2pu
transaction
33fb572598f65150570baaebd59a058c96c077aa2e984d2197dfccccdb7179e9